Next-Level Video Content
Short-form video remains one of the most effective
tools for reaching audiences on platforms such as Instagram, TikTok, and Facebook Reels.
In 2025, brands that prioritise authentic videos—whether behind-the-scenes glimpses,
product showcases, or team stories—see stronger returns on engagement. Vertical formats,
creative editing techniques, and use of sound or subtitles are now essential.
Immersive
video experiences, like interactive 360-degree content or AR filters, are making social
feeds more engaging and memorable. Although these require more production effort, the
resulting interaction helps brands form deeper connections with digital communities.
Authenticity and Inclusive Visuals
The trend towards unfiltered, real
content is growing. Audiences respond to visuals that reflect true diversity and genuine
moments, rather than overly polished advertising. This means featuring a mix of ages,
backgrounds, and real-life scenarios—images that users can relate to and trust.
Consistent
brand visuals—fonts, colours, and visual themes—help maintain recognition while still
allowing room for creative risks. Experiment with hand-drawn graphics, bold colour
palettes, and expressive type to give your brand a signature look in crowded feeds.
Staying Adaptable With Visual Content
The fast-moving nature of social
channels means trends evolve quickly. Regularly monitor top-performing posts, and be
willing to adapt your visual style when necessary. This agility keeps your brand
relevant and maximises impact.
Finally, accessibility is central to
successful visual content in 2025. Use alt text, high-contrast design, and captions so
all audiences can enjoy your content. As visual trends shift, these inclusivity
practices set your brand apart for the right reasons.
